Reviews written by sarrsun
2 results - showing 1 - 2
Ordering
June 20, 2022
(Updated: November 30, -1)
Overall rating
5.0
Service
5.0
Pricing
5.0
Quality
5.0
Delivery
5.0
SARMS & Peptides Stores
S
July 21, 2021
(Updated: November 30, -1)
Overall rating
2.8
Service
1.0
Pricing
2.0
Quality
4.0
Delivery
4.0
SARMS & Peptides Stores
S
2 results - showing 1 - 2